Websites with no cancellation fees for booking Universal Hotel
Hi
Just wondering if you can offer any reputable website for booking 1 night at a Universal Hotel with free cancellation? I already have a night booked via Booking.com with free cancellation, just looking at potentially moving my date but they don't have the room type I have booked (kids suite) on any other date during my holiday. Have found it on other sites, but they have cancellation fees. |

I usually book with Universal direct. If you have revolut or a currency card with USD on it then you can pay using that. Free cancellation and their refunds usually take about 5-7 days to come back to you. I've had so many that I've booked and cancelled over the last year I'm surprised i'm not blacklisted!

I've booked 1 nighters (have to pay full amount) and i've booked multi nights (deposit only) and have had them all refunded when cancelled with no issues. But if you're looking for a guarantee then booking.com usually has free cancellation rates available and i believe travel republic has low deposits so you may only lose like £15 or something like that.

I always book directly with Loews. They take a one night deposit but it is refundable, there is no minimum nights.
